Replacing the Hard Drive Fan
1 Follow the procedures in "Before You Begin" on page 13.
2 Remove the computer cover (see "Replacing the Computer Cover" on
3 Remove all installed memory modules (see "Replacing Memory
4 Disconnect the fan cable from the FAN_CPU_FRONT connector on the
Master Control Board (see "Master Control Board" on page 12).
5 Press the release latch on the hard drive fan and slide it away from the hard
drive bays and lift to remove from the computer.
